Can You Get A Tattoo At 15 With Parental Consent

Can You Get A Tattoo At 15 With Parental Consent - However, if you’re under 18, you’re considered a minor, and getting a tattoo depends on the regulations of the state you’re in. 52 rows most states permit a person under the age of 18 to receive a tattoo with permission of a parent or guardian, but some states prohibit. If you’re 18 or older, you don’t need your parents’ consent to get a tattoo. Parental consent and presence required: In the united states, the minimum age requirement for getting a tattoo is 18. Minors under 18 can get a tattoo with a parent or guardian present to sign a consent form, provided they show a valid id and birth certificate.
